Job/Volunteer Opportunities For Youth
Highlighted at Job/Activities Fair

Summer employment, volunteer and camp opportunities for youth between the ages of six and 22 will be featured at a jobs/activities fair to be held on March 3, from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m., at the Gwendolyn E. Coffield Community Center, 2450 Lyttonsville Rd., Silver Spring.

Entitled "Silver Summer," the fair will provide information from more than two dozen sources on summer jobs, training programs, summer camps and volunteer openings available in Silver Spring. Staff from local businesses, non-profit and government agencies will be present to talk with participants and accept applications.

Included among the providers will be the YMCA; Maryland Job Corps; Fresh Fields/Whole Fields, Inc.; Manpower, Inc.; Jack & Jill of America; Montgomery College, College Corps, Inc.; Montgomery County Public Schools, Montgomery County Conservation Corps; Silver Spring Urban Crew and Service Corps; Montgomery Youth Works; Montgomery County Recreation Department; Montgomery County Volunteer Center; the American Red Cross; Coalition of 100 Black Women; Edison Technical High School; Bethesda and Silver Spring Youth Services; and the Silver Spring Boys & Girls Clubs.

Teens 14 and older can sign up for free job readiness training to be offered in the spring. Business professionals from various fields will present seminars on topics such as good work habits, resume writing, interview skills and personal presentation.

Also, for the first time, the Montgomery County Public Schools and the County's Volunteer Center will be available to distribute information on positions offering Volunteer Student Service Learning Credits.

The job/activities fair is sponsored by the Silver Spring Coalition and the Greater Rosemary Hills Human Resources Coalition.
